Transaction e5d622156481b3c442a712163c514fd95189a0edc74e60f50c742da567e25088
1 Input
1 Output
-
e5d622156481b3c442a712163c514fd95189a0edc74e60f50c742da567e25088:0
- value
- 97450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d359c455a2431bb01d9c8b0aa49266cd7fb19866 OP_EQUAL
- address
- 3LxY38pqx6UEXbNni7NmBBNyrzpGfCwod6